Taylor Swift, the global pop sensation, has once again captured the world’s attention, not just with her chart-topping music but with her extraordinary act of generosity. During her iconic Eras Tour, she surprised her dedicated truck drivers with ‘life-changing’ $100,000 bonuses, a gesture that left both the recipients and the business world astounded. Beyond making headlines, this remarkable act has set a new standard for employee appreciation and corporate giving, demonstrating the emotional impact of recognizing and valuing the hard work of behind-the-scenes workers.   1. Recognizing the Unsung Heroes

Taylor Swift’s decision to reward her Eras Tour truck drivers with substantial bonuses shines a spotlight on the unsung heroes of the entertainment industry. Just like in any business, there are individuals who work tirelessly behind the scenes, often unnoticed, to ensure the smooth functioning and success of the company. Acknowledging and appreciating these hardworking individuals can foster a sense of camaraderie and loyalty within the workforce.

Lesson for Businesses: Take the time to recognize and celebrate the efforts of all employees, not just those in the limelight. Employee recognition programs can go a long way in boosting morale and creating a positive work environment.

  1. The Power of Gratitude

Taylor Swift’s emotional expression of gratitude towards her truck drivers during a live concert resonated deeply with her fans and the broader audience. The power of showing genuine appreciation cannot be underestimated. When employees feel valued and appreciated, they are more likely to be motivated, engaged, and committed to their work.

Lesson for Businesses: Encourage a culture of gratitude and appreciation within the workplace. Simple gestures such as saying ‘thank you’ or recognizing outstanding performance can make a significant difference in employee satisfaction and productivity.

  1. Emotional Connection with Employees

Taylor Swift’s act of generosity was not just a financial transaction; it was a heartfelt gesture that created an emotional connection with her truck drivers and fans alike. Her sincerity and empathy towards her team have strengthened the emotional bond between them, leading to increased loyalty and dedication.

Lesson for Businesses: Foster emotional connections with employees by promoting open communication, empathetic leadership, and active listening. When employees feel valued as individuals, they are more likely to give their best and contribute to the company’s success.

  1. Setting a Positive Example

Taylor Swift’s act of giving ‘life-changing’ bonuses has set a positive example for other artists and businesses across industries. It highlights the importance of corporate social responsibility and the role of successful individuals in giving back to the community that supports them.

Lesson for Businesses: Corporate giving is not just a checkbox on a sustainability report; it is an opportunity to make a real difference in the lives of employees and the community. Embrace philanthropy and social responsibility as integral components of your business strategy.

  1. Boosting Employee Morale

The impact of Taylor Swift’s bonuses on the Eras Tour truck drivers’ morale cannot be overstated. These once-overlooked employees now feel valued, respected, and motivated to continue delivering their best efforts.

Lesson for Businesses: Invest in employee well-being and job satisfaction. Offer competitive compensation, benefits, and opportunities for growth and development. A happy and motivated workforce will lead to higher productivity and better business outcomes.

  1. Positive Public Relations

Taylor Swift’s act of generosity has garnered significant media attention and positive public relations for her brand. It showcases her as not only a talented artist but also a compassionate and socially responsible individual.

Lesson for Businesses: Corporate philanthropy can be a powerful tool for building a positive brand image. Engage in charitable initiatives that align with your company’s values and mission, and communicate these efforts effectively to your audience.

  1. Inspiring Leadership

Taylor Swift’s leadership in demonstrating appreciation for her team has inspired others to follow suit. Several artists and businesses have taken note and increased their support for their behind-the-scenes employees.

Lesson for Businesses: Leadership by example is a potent catalyst for change. As a leader, show genuine appreciation for your employees and create a workplace culture that values their contributions.

Taylor Swift’s act of giving ‘life-changing’ bonuses to her Eras Tour truck drivers serves as a shining example of the power of employee appreciation and corporate social responsibility. Beyond the financial impact, her gesture has created an emotional connection with her team, fans, and the wider community. Businesses can learn valuable lessons from this remarkable act, including the importance of recognizing unsung heroes, fostering gratitude, and embracing corporate giving. By implementing these principles, companies can create a positive work culture, boost employee morale, and achieve greater success in the long run. As we celebrate Taylor Swift’s philanthropy, let us remember that small acts of kindness can have a profound impact, leaving a lasting legacy of compassion and empathy in the business world.
